New Logo Design

I was assigned to make a new CSMS logo for their class Distributed Systems.

This was a bit tricky to figure out since there weren’t too many references provided to base a logo off of so I made a few draft designs.

They emphasized distribution amongst computers but we decided that two computers made the logo feel too busy. My supervisor provided me with some better icon references and I started to go off of those.

This project is still in the works, but these new designs worked well with the clients so now we can decide and start animating.

STA Posters!!

Our team was requested to make new STA team posters and to make it a special surprise, they were going to be inspired from real movie posters! This was an especially fun project as emulating movie posters is always very charming and I was given the task to make posters after The Breakfast Club and Clue.

The Breakfast Club was surprisingly challenging as the students in the poster were wearing very similar colors.

We eventually decided to change to a different poster type and change the colors of the students clothing.

My supervisors helped a lot with the coloring and changing the STA shirt colors but eventually it was good to send. Next was the Computer Support poster. Here are some of the iterations.

These were fun to do and I love the computer motif

Back From an Insane Summer

I can’t say I had much of a summer break as I spent my summer doing the UT Semester in Los Angeles Program where I essentially worked around the clock. But it was one of the most beneficial experiences I’ve had at UT (besides being an STA of course).

I spent my summer in LA completing internships and taking Hollywood based classes provided by the program. I interned at MorningStar Entertainment and HappyNest Entertainment, 2 very different types of production experiences as MorningStar was mainly a history and true crime documentary production company and HappyNest is a kids animation distribution company. The experiences I gained from both companies was absolutely crucial to my growth as an animation student. While I have many technical skills in animation, I learned so much about pitching, negotiating, budgeting, and the inner workings of producing a well-made story.

While the internship is the main seller of the UTLA program, I’d say some of my most valuable experiences was all the animators I met who were super kind and made it obvious that all they wanted to do was to help animators break into a very scary industry. They were kind enough to get coffee with me and even show me around their workplaces!

I think what I took away most from the UTLA program is how to prioritize my work schedule and realizing that I’m very capable of hard work despite my inner monologue. I was always working and always networking and when I wasn’t working, I was seeing friends and going to different events. I never really had a day off. I not only want to take that work ethic into my career, but also as an STA to make sure the projects I get are up to my best ability.

Foundations of Data Science Logo and Animation

We have settled on a logo design!

The gears were a favorite for the client. Now I had to animate it.

This was a lot more tricky than I thought it would be because gears are surprisingly very complex. At least for me. Getting the timing right for the gear turning was a concern as a lot of the time the turning of one gear would offset the others and it would turn into a domino effect.

Luckily, I was suggested to slow down the turning which not only helped the pacing, but lessened the risk of the gears being offset. Here’s what I was able to finish with.
